Are you an experienced BMS Design Manager looking to work on one of the UK's most significant life sciences infrastructure programmes?

Do you have a passion for delivering technically complex, smart, and secure building systems in regulated environments?

Then Crown House Technologies is the company for you! We are looking for a BMS Design Manager to join our team to support the delivery of our flagship life sciences facility that will set new benchmarks in performance, resilience, and digital integration.

As BMS Design Manager, you will be responsible for leading the design and coordination of Building Management Systems on a large, technically demanding life sciences development.

Your focus will be on ensuring that the BMS design meets the highest standards of performance, compliance, and integration—supporting a facility with stringent operational and environmental controls.

Key Responsibilities
  • Manage the full BMS design lifecycle from concept through to technical assurance and handover
  • Lead coordination across MEP, ICT, digital engineering, and controls specialists
  • Oversee compliance with design standards, regulatory requirements, and project performance targets
  • Review and manage technical submittals, drawings, and control strategies
  • Interface with client, consultants, and delivery teams to ensure smooth design progression
  • Support commissioning and validation planning for integrated building systems
What Do We Look For?
Essential:
  • Strong technical knowledge of BMS systems, controls architecture, and integration
  • Experience managing BMS design on large-scale or highly serviced buildings (e.g., labs, healthcare, cleanrooms)
  • Excellent coordination and communication skills
  • Familiarity with UK standards (e.g., CIBSE, EN15232) and digital design processes
  • Experience collaborating with multidisciplinary teams and external consultants
  • Eligibility for UK security clearance (or ability to gain it if required)
Desirable:
  • Understanding of regulated environments, validation processes, and building performance compliance
  • Experience with platforms such as Trend, Tridium, Siemens, Schneider, or similar
  • Knowledge of cybersecurity and IT network considerations in BMS design
  • Experience with BIM tools and model-based design workflows

Crown House Technologies (CHT) is one of the UK's most advanced and innovative engineering and business services specialists. Part of the Laing O'Rourke Group, and founded on more than 200 years of experience, we are a leading construction and infrastructure technology services provider, supplying a complete Building Services package with communications, ICT, intelligent building, monitoring, BMS, and the UK's largest mechanical, electrical & public health manufacturing facility—a 129,000 sq. ft factory offering off-site manufacturing and assembly for our digitally engineered modular M&E packages.
